From April 14-May 31, 2020 DIGITAL SCENT FESTIVAL held a six-week-long virtual event celebrating: Intersectionality and Perfumery: art / culture / music / sustainability / wellness / future Digital Scent Festival is a spontaneous co-production between YOSH and Aroma Village - a collective of independent perfumers and artists. Our rockstar list of olfactive talent offers illuminating conversations with VIP access from the comfort of your own personal device. Digital Scent Festival was born out of a need to connect during the pandemic and create a space where our noses remain curious and active. We will broadcast a limited series of events and encourage soulful connections through olfactive unity. On this platform, we share knowledge about Decolonizing Scent.
